Well I got my T1510 back from the dealer and I spent about 2 hours in my dad's garden.
It hasn't been tilled in 2 years and the year prior to that he had laid down landscaping cloth / weed fabric.
The weeds grew through it and it was literally rotting when you try and pull it up by hand.
I don't want all that fabric getting wound around the tines and shafts of my "gotta get yet" rear tiller
I tried scraping off the top 2 -3 inches to get rid of the fabric, but as normal, the bucket wanted to do 6 inches deep.
So, I spread everything around and handpicked the fabric out and then dragged everything back in the holes.
I guess that is what I get without having the right implements yet. A box blade probably would have been nice to use here.
But like they say....any seat time is fun time. (Even with or without the right implements.)
